Rep. James Comer Praises Kamala Harris as ‘Great Candidate for Republicans’

On ‘The Ingraham Angle,’ Rep. James Comer, R-Ky., made a notable statement regarding Kamala Harris, suggesting she is a ‘great candidate for Republicans.’ This comment was delivered in the context of Comer’s ongoing investigation into former President Joe Biden’s cognitive abilities while in office. The discussion also touched on Harris’ decision not to run for California governor, which Comer addressed during the segment.

Comer’s remarks have sparked varied reactions, with some observers finding it surprising given the political dynamics at play.
